§ 26:1A-106 — Department of Institutions and Agencies as agency for rendering welfare assistance

Notwithstanding the provisions of this act, the Department of Institutions and Agencies shall continue to be the sole State agency for the rendering of welfare assistance to the permanently and totally disabled and to needy persons in such other categories of assistance as is now or may be authorized hereafter by law. L.1952, c. 102, p. 443, s. 15.
